Pyramiding superior haplotypes and epistatic alleles to accelerate wood quality and yield improvement in poplar breeding
Industrial Crops and Products(2021)
摘要
•A novel marker-assisted selection approach improves industrial pulpwood products.•Multi-omics analyses reveal the pleiotropy of wood-related genes in Populus.•Pyramiding gene module was designed to improve industrial pulpwood traits.•Simulating haplotype- and phenotype-based selection in early-period breeding.
